pulsesrc: Implement GstStreamVolume interface

PulseAudio 1.0 supports per-source-output volumes, and this exposes the
functionality via the GstStreamVolume interface.

When compiled against pre-1.0 PulseAudio, the interface is not
implemented, and using the "volume" or "mute" property is a no-op. This
bit of ugliness will go away when we can depend on PulseAudio 1.0 or
greater.
